Open Systems acquires Sqooba to add network and business analytics

Open Systems, a secure access service edge (SASE) with cloud-native architecture, secure intelligent edge, and hybrid cloud support, added significant new capabilities to its platform with the acquisition of Sqooba, a Swiss-based provider of big data analytics. Sqooba uses art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) to provide real-time visibility across the enterprise operations and business applications. (more…)

Esri partners with OSI to provide advanced GIS capabilities and real-time monitoring to utilities

Esri, the global provider of location intelligence, announced it has entered into a partnership with Open Systems International, Inc. (OSI). Their joint customers in the electric, gas, and water utility industries will now be able to leverage both Esri’s ArcGIS Utility Network Management as part of their geographic information system (GIS) and OSI’s monarch operational technology (OT) platform.
